The next step is to prepare the flex that will be used. The first step is to remove the sheathing from the flex in order to expose the three conductors insulated within. Use a utility blade to cut the sheathing beyond the cord grip at the entry point of the plug. This will not penetrate the insulated conductors. The nick should be wide enough to allow the sheathing to split and expand the nick when it is pulled back, revealing the cable beneath. Cut off the excess sheathing leaving about 40mm beyond the flex. The flex is positioned over the plug, with the earth terminal at the top and the live and neutral terminals at the bottom. The sheathing around each pin is removed using conductors in the colour of the wire as a guide. The internal cable is then inserted into the terminal with the help of the cord grip. If the plug has a clamp for cords that is screw-type, loosen it and then pull the insulation back to expose the copper wires. Connect each wire that is insulated to the correct terminal by using the channel inside the plug. Start with the earth conductor and then the neutral and then the live. In the UK the majority of dual fuel range cookers are hard-wired. They are not able to be plugged directly into the wall outlet. They are usually connected to a specific cooker ring circuit that is suitable for appliances that consume up to 20 amps. Examine the ring circuit in your home by using the fuse box, or ask an electrician nearby. They should be able to tell you if the sockets within your home are connected to the same ring or are separate and if there is a separate circuit for your oven.
